Texas county rescinds data center moratorium after lawsuit

Hill County, Texas, rescinded its data center moratorium after a developer sued for $100 million.

Summary

Hill County, Texas, has rescinded its data center moratorium after being sued by a developer for $100 million. The county commissioners voted unanimously to replace the moratorium with a checklist of requirements for developers. The lawsuit, filed by RCM Hill, LLC, argues that the county exceeded its lawful powers. The county judge stated that the moratorium helped identify less desirable projects and provided time to develop the checklist. The company has existing contracts to buy more than 800 acres of land for a data center project.
